Aksana Zabara, CFA

Meet Aksana

Aksana directs the research, development, and implementation of client portfolio strategic asset allocations. She is deputy chair of the Opportunistic Subcommittee, conducting investment diligence and selection of non-traditional strategies for dislocated markets. She also leads Strategic’s analyst program. She is a member of Strategic’s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ion Committee, a cross-functional team that works to encourage and evaluate diversity within our sphere of influence (our firm, our managers, our vendors) and to foster an equitable and respectful work environment throughout the firm. Prior to joining Strategic, she worked as a Loan/Benefit Officer at a local retirement trust company.

Aksana holds an M.B.A. from Georgetown University’s McDonough School of Business and a B.S. in Finance from George Mason University. She is a CFA charterholder and a member of the CFA Society of Washington, D.C.
